But instead of made up of a liquid electrolyte, they consist of solid lithium electrodes. Sakti3’s prototype reliable-condition battery cells have a high energy density, offering them the likely to boost the density of currently’s most State-of-the-art liquid lithium ion batteries, even though also getting smaller, safer, additional trusted and more time Long lasting.
Just before Anyone starts talking about the upcoming arrival with the God Battery, nevertheless, some critical caveats. Most of the specialized information continue to be solution. The energy-density claims have but being independently confirmed.

Turning a little prototype cell into a highway-worthy vehicle battery is a huge and uncertain undertaking. Along with the battery marketplace contains a happy, century-prolonged custom of overpromising and underdelivering.
It’s very easy to see why. The electrolyte in a lithium-ion battery can be a liquid not unlike gasoline, and it’s liable for a lot of the secondary chemical reactions that as time passes degrade batteries or, even worse, trigger meltdowns and fires.

The corporation grew out in the engineering Section of your University of Michigan. Sometime in 2006, Sastry and her colleagues started executing advanced mathematical optimization techniques trying to figure out which of the many competing variables that go into an electric auto battery—Electricity, power, mass, volume, Expense, basic safety—could give.

Due to the delicacy with the liquid electrolyte, lithium-ion battery packs used in autos tend to be shrouded in packaging—liquid cooling tubes, electronic controls, and the like. People things add Expense and pounds.
